Position Summary:
This role serves as Chief of Staff to the NUSA Chief Procurement Officer (CPO) and leads Procurement Strategy, Functional Development, Transformation, Governance, and Capability Building for Nestle USA. The role is responsible for defining long-term direction, driving major strategic initiatives, building organizational capabilities, establishing and maintaining governance processes, and enabling execution of procurement priorities that deliver business value.
As a trusted advisor to the CPO and Procurement Leadership Team, this role creates and maintains the short- and long-term Procurement strategy across key planning horizons, translating the CPO vision and enterprise priorities into a clear roadmap, governance system, and execution agenda. This is accomplished through close collaboration with Procurement leadership, global teams, business partners, and critical stakeholders across related functions.
The Director is expected to bring strong external orientation, including marketplace awareness, consumer-packaged goods industry trends, procurement best practices, and insights from networks, councils, conferences, and benchmarking. The role prepares executive presentations, reports, recommendations, and strategic communications for the CPO and senior leaders while providing strategic direction and governance to the Procurement organization.
The role also leads the functional development strategy and team, ensuring Procurement builds the capabilities, leadership readiness, ways of working, and talent pipeline required to deliver on the function’s vision. The Director fosters a culture of continuous improvement, innovation, collaboration, accountability, and disciplined execution across the procurement function.
This role will work a hybrid schedule, in office and work from home, and is required to be located in either Solon, Ohio, greater Cleveland, or Arlington, Virginia, Greater D.C.
Job Responsibilities:
1. Chief of Staff & Procurement Leadership Team Effectiveness
- Serve as Chief of Staff and strategic advisor to the NUSA CPO and Procurement Leadership Team, supporting priority-setting, decision-making, executive communications, and leadership alignment.
- Translate complex functional and business needs into clear recommendations, tradeoffs, actions, and leadership routines that enable disciplined follow-through.
- Prepare senior-level presentations, reports, and strategic updates that connect Procurement priorities, performance, risks, and decisions needed.
2. Procurement Strategy & Future Capability Development
- Develop and maintain Procurement's multi-year strategic roadmap across short-(Y+1), medium-(3 year), and long-term (5+ year) horizons aligned to enterprise priorities and the CPO vision, ensuring clear and intentional linkage to global, NUSA and One Operations strategies and priorities.
- Serve as the function's external lens by identifying market trends, best practices, emerging technologies, competitor activity, and future capability requirements through research, benchmarking, conferences, councils, and professional networks.
- Define and design new capabilities via relationships with functional and business leaders, market research, industry conferences, etc.
- Translate external insights into strategic priorities, capability roadmaps, and opportunities that strengthen Procurement's impact and future readiness.
- Lead the functional development strategy and team, ensuring Procurement builds the skills, capabilities, leadership readiness, and ways of working required to deliver the roadmap.
3. Strategic Initiatives & Transformation
- Lead or shape major strategic initiatives that advance Procurement priorities, strengthen the operating model, and accelerate business value creation.
- Provide strategic direction, prioritization, governance, and stakeholder alignment for complex cross-functional programs and proof-of-concept efforts.
- Ensure initiatives are connected to the broader Procurement roadmap and supported through clear ownership, adoption planning, communication, and change enablement.
4. Governance, Performance & Business Planning
- Establish governance processes and operating routines that drive accountability, visibility, and execution discipline across Procurement priorities.
- Maintain strategic roadmap and risk documentation across key planning horizons, monitoring progress, dependencies, decisions needed, and leadership support required.
- Partner with the Procurement Finance Co-Pilot to coordinate annual budgets, financial forecasts, performance metrics, and business planning inputs for the function.
5. Stakeholder Leadership, Enterprise Alignment & Organizational Adoption
- Build and maintain strong relationships across Procurement, businesses, functions, global teams, and external partners to align direction and advance strategic objectives.
- Harmonize Procurement priorities with enterprise initiatives, functional strategies, and global direction to strengthen decision quality and organizational consistency.
- Lead communication, engagement, and change efforts that build understanding, reinforce accountability, and embed new capabilities, processes, and ways of working.
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ree required. Preferred: Master’s degree in Supply Chain, Business, Finance, Accounting, Economics, Mathematics, Marketing, Industrial Engineering, or related field.
- 10+ years of procurement, purchasing, strategic planning, chief of staff, transformation, finance, business operations, or related functional leadership experience.
- In-depth knowledge of procurement and sourcing processes, contract negotiations, contract management, supplier management, cost optimization, and value creation.
- Demonstrated success developing multi-year strategies, leading complex initiatives, building organizational capabilities, and translating strategy into measurable business results.
- Exceptional interpersonal skills and proven ability to influence senior leaders, global teams, cross-functional partners, and diverse stakeholders through strong communication, executive presence, and relationship-building skills.
- Strategic mindset with strong analytical, problem-solving, project management, change leadership, and decision-quality skills, including the ability to manage ambiguity and drive alignment.
- Strong understanding of market trends, external benchmarking, and the consumer-packaged goods industry, with the ability to translate insights into practical functional priorities.
